That reminds me of an interesting subject. Mike was sick and needed some ibuprophen. All drugs, even non prescription drugs, must be purchased at a Farmacia. Mike went to a Farmacia and had to pay e4.15 for 12 pills of ibuprophen. We bought a 1000 tablet bottle at Bimart in Corvallis for $9.99.
